Will be happy to help should you have any … WebApr 24, 2024 · Out-File: Access to the path 'C:\MyFiles' is denied. The issue was that I was redirecting the output (" My text ") to a directory and not a file. I had to modify it this way by specifying the file ( program.txt ): Out-File -FilePath C:\MyFiles\program.txt -InputObject "My text". This time it worked out fine.

WebThe Export-CSV cmdlet creates a CSV file of the objects that you submit. Each object is a row that includes a character-separated list of the object's property values. You can use the Export-CSV cmdlet to create spreadsheets and share data with programs that accept CSV files as input. Do not format objects before sending them to the Export-CSV cmdlet.
